STIL comment"This game was based on the well known board game. Tune 2 is a weird victory ditty that was composed by my brother. Tune 3 I think is the highscore music and tune 4 is the ingame music, just a 2 channel ambient track which left 1 channel for sfx. Tune 5 seems to be corrupt and out of sync for some reason but was meant to be used for action parts of the game." (MC)
 
SUBTUNE INFO
 
#4
 
  Comment: On the original tape and disk, 6 bytes are corrupt, causing the arpeggio to fall out of sync at 0:05 like Mark says. This rip replaces them by 6 bytes that are repeated before and after.
